CA 2517953

A novel human or rat polypeptide useful in improving and/or preventing organ fibrosis; a polynucleotide encoding the polypeptide; an expression vector containing the polynucleotide; and a cell transfected with the expression vector. This polynucleotide shows a remarkable decrease in the expression dose in the kidney of a chronic renal insufficiency model rat or in the bladder of a rat suffering from the induction of fibrotic conditions in the bladder, compared with a normal individual. Overexpression of the polypeptide suppresses the production of extracellular matrix. The promoter region of the above polypeptide; a method of screening a remedy for fibrotic conditions; and a process for producing a medicinal composition for improving fibrotic conditions which contains a substance obtained by the above screening method as the active ingredient.
